How they compare

Papua New Guinea currently reports 0.2258 against 0.2221 in Iceland, a difference of 0.0037.

The two have swapped places 30 times across 64 shared years of data; in 1960 it was Papua New Guinea ahead.

Iceland ranks 53rd and Papua New Guinea ranks 51st of 189 countries.

Across the 7 decades both report, Iceland averaged higher in 6 and Papua New Guinea in 1.

Head to head by decade

Decade Iceland Papua New Guinea Difference Ahead
1960s -0.2499 0.1142 0.3641 Papua New Guinea
1970s 0.5134 0.3309 0.1824 Iceland
1980s 0.2356 -0.0173 0.253 Iceland
1990s 0.6935 -0.5425 1.24 Iceland
2000s 0.8361 0.0676 0.7685 Iceland
2010s 0.9778 0.1385 0.8393 Iceland
2020s 0.8032 0.1492 0.6541 Iceland

Averages of every year both report within each decade.

The SPEI fulfills the requirements of a drought index since its multi-scalar character enables it to be used by different scientific disciplines to detect, monitor, and analyze droughts. Like the sc-PDSI and the SPI, the SPEI can measure drought severity according to its intensity and duration, and can identify the onset and end of drought episodes. The SPEI allows comparison of drought severity through time and space, since it can be calculated over a wide range of climates, as can the SPI.
